当前位置:首页 > 综合资讯 > 正文
黑狐家游戏

云服务器怎么搭建数据库,云服务器搭建数据库全攻略,步骤详解与技巧分享

云服务器怎么搭建数据库,云服务器搭建数据库全攻略,步骤详解与技巧分享

云服务器搭建数据库攻略,涵盖详细步骤及实用技巧,助您快速搭建高效数据库,提升业务性能。...

云服务器搭建数据库攻略,涵盖详细步骤及实用技巧,助您快速搭建高效数据库,提升业务性能。

随着互联网的快速发展,数据库已经成为企业、个人开发的重要基础设施,云服务器作为云服务的一种,具有高可靠性、可扩展性、低成本等优势,成为搭建数据库的理想平台,本文将详细介绍如何在云服务器上搭建数据库,包括步骤详解与技巧分享。

选择合适的云服务器

1、云服务提供商:目前市场上主流的云服务提供商有阿里云、腾讯云、华为云等,选择合适的云服务提供商可以根据自身需求和预算进行。

2、云服务器配置:根据数据库的规模和需求,选择合适的云服务器配置,需要考虑CPU、内存、存储、带宽等因素。

3、数据库类型:常见的数据库类型有MySQL、Oracle、SQL Server、MongoDB等,选择合适的数据库类型要根据实际需求进行。

搭建数据库

1、准备工作

云服务器怎么搭建数据库,云服务器搭建数据库全攻略,步骤详解与技巧分享

(1)登录云服务器:使用云服务提供商提供的登录方式(如SSH、远程桌面等)登录到云服务器。

(2)安装数据库:根据所选数据库类型,在云服务器上安装相应的数据库软件,以下以MySQL为例进行说明。

2、安装MySQL

(1)使用命令行工具登录云服务器。

(2)使用以下命令安装MySQL:

sudo apt-get update
sudo apt-get install mysql-server

(3)启动MySQL服务:

sudo systemctl start mysql

(4)设置MySQL密码:

sudo mysql_secure_installation

3、配置MySQL

(1)编辑MySQL配置文件(/etc/mysql/my.cnf):

sudo nano /etc/mysql/my.cnf

(2)修改以下配置项:

云服务器怎么搭建数据库,云服务器搭建数据库全攻略,步骤详解与技巧分享

[mysqld]
bind-address = 0.0.0.0

(3)保存并退出编辑。

(4)重启MySQL服务:

sudo systemctl restart mysql

4、创建数据库

(1)使用以下命令登录MySQL:

mysql -u root -p

(2)创建数据库:

CREATE DATABASE your_database_name;

(3)创建用户:

CREATE USER 'username'@'%' IDENTIFIED BY 'password';

(4)授权用户:

GRANT ALL PRIVILEGES ON your_database_name.* TO 'username'@'%';

(5)刷新权限:

FLUSH PRIVILEGES;

(6)退出MySQL:

EXIT;

数据库安全与优化

1、数据库安全

云服务器怎么搭建数据库,云服务器搭建数据库全攻略,步骤详解与技巧分享

(1)设置强密码:为数据库用户设置强密码,防止密码泄露。

(2)限制访问:仅允许授权用户访问数据库,禁止匿名访问。

(3)定期备份数据:定期备份数据库,以防数据丢失。

2、数据库优化

(1)索引优化:合理设计索引,提高查询效率。

(2)查询优化:优化SQL语句,提高查询速度。

(3)硬件升级:根据数据库规模,适当升级云服务器硬件配置。

本文详细介绍了在云服务器上搭建数据库的步骤和技巧,在实际操作过程中,请根据实际情况进行调整,希望本文对您有所帮助。

黑狐家游戏

发表评论

最新文章